Xiao Long Bao

Xiao Long Bao, also known as soup dumplings, are a popular Chinese delicacy. They are traditionally filled with pork and a savory broth that's deliciously warming.

Let's Get Started

  1. Mix the gelatin with the chicken broth and refrigerate until it forms a jelly.
  2. Combine the pork, soy sauce, sugar, green onions, and ginger in a bowl. Cut the jelly into small cubes and mix it into the pork filling.
  3. Dissolve the yeast in the warm water. Combine the flour and salt in a separate bowl, then gradually add the yeast water, mixing until a dough forms.
  4. Knead the dough until it's smooth and elastic, then let it rest for 2 hours.
  5. Roll out the dough and cut it into small circles. Place a spoonful of the pork filling in the center of each circle.
  6. Fold the edges of the dough over the filling, pleating as you go, until the dumpling is sealed.
  7. Steam the dumplings for 10 minutes, or until the pork is cooked through.
  8. Serve the dumplings hot, with soy sauce for dipping.
